  10. Quite correct. The NSDAP was originally known as the German Worker's Party. It was founded by Anton Drexler, who was anti-Capitalist, but also anti-Marxist. Hitler, out of work, and without a future, was attracted to Drexler's rhetoric, and Drexler effectively mentored him. To suppose that Adolf Hitler was a "Marxist" is utter nonsense. Drexler drifted around various parties during WW1 , basically opposed to the war. He hatched an idea to form an organisation to "combat the Marxism of the free trade unions". He wanted something that was Nationalist, ie loving Germany, but which also represented the working man, because the established conservative parties represented the imperial classes. He espoused something called "National Socialism". In 1919 Germany, that didn't mean the same as the shakey understanding held in 2025 America. He utterly repudiated Marx and the Left. Today, we would call him a Populist politician. Hitler had this idea to rename the party; his ideology utterly repudiated Marx, and he felt he had a third way between capitalism and socialism, but the word socialism was winning votes, and he needed those, so he rebranded using a term he defined as his third way. 100 years on, idiots spout that he was really a communist-marxist, and all those fights between Brownshirts and Marxists were just fiction.
